In 1991, #EastTimor voted for independence from Indonesia, the country that essentially took them over in 1975 when Portugal left. Instead of a smooth democratic process, Indonesia murdered civilians and tried to remove voters for independence. Here, Birmingham illustrates how he sees Australia to have stood by and allowed it to happen. I would have liked a little more background, as this is something I knew nothing about, but this is a really👇🏼

Hooked_on_books interesting read that taught me a lot. Be aware that there are some graphic depictions of murder and death in this one. #ReadingAsia2021 #TimorLeste 3y

Author: David Soman and Jacky Davis
Genre: Realistic Fiction
“No need to fear! The Bug Squad is here!” Ladybug Girl and Bumblebee Boy is a realistic fiction (RF)about a little girl's adventure at the playground. When she and her friend can't agree on what to play she suggest he joins her and plays Ladybug girl. Together they show off their power on the playground and save a helpless pup from an evil derange squirrel. This book would be fantastic

LauraLeighn for Partner Reading (PR) weather that means each student takes turns reading each page or if they assign parts and read for their character. I think ESOL strategy 10. Teach think, pair, and share strategies in cooperative groups would go great with the PR. It would be great to encourage the students to be thinking critically as they read, let them bounce ideas off each other. This ESOL strategy plays well with UDL 9.3 (Develop self-assessment and 4y
LauraLeighn reflection) since you can encourage any student to think pair share as well as reflect on what they are reading. TeacherVision has some great lesson resources for this book as well, with fun activity pages, and reading assessments. https://www.teachervision.com/childrens-book/ladybug-girl-bumblebee-boy-activity... #ucflae3414SU20 4y
